A frank, funny and powerful true story of life with Tourette’s, from misunderstood teen to outspoken advocate
The film that has got everyone talking after its surprise BAFTA Best Actor win, I Swear charts John Davidson MBE’s journey from a misunderstood teenager in 1980s Scotland to a powerful advocate for awareness and acceptance of Tourette syndrome. Diagnosed at 15, John faces bullying, stigma and a system that barely understands his condition. As he grows into adulthood, he finds purpose in speaking out, educating others and refusing to be defined solely by his tics. Kirk Jones balances humour and heartbreak with a light touch, creating a moving, accessible portrait of resilience, community and the transformative power of empathy.
Director: Kirk Jones
Cast: Robert Aramayo, Maxine Peake, Shirley Henderson, Peter Mullan, Scott Ellis Watson
